Re: [R] passing an extra argument to an S3 generic
For these type of setups, I typically turn to default values, e.g. hatvalues.mlm - function(model, m=1, infl=NULL, ...) { if (is.null(infl)) { infl - mlm.influence(model, m=m, do.coef=FALSE); } hat - infl$H m - infl$m names(hat) - if(m==1) infl$subsets else apply(infl$subsets,1, paste, collapse=',') hat } So people may prefer to do the following: hatvalues.mlm - function(model, m=1, infl, ...) { if (missing(infl)) { infl - mlm.influence(model, m=m, do.coef=FALSE); } hat - infl$H m - infl$m names(hat) - if(m==1) infl$subsets else apply(infl$subsets,1, paste, collapse=',') hat } The downside with this approach is that args(fcn) doesn't reveal the default behavior; instead you need to document it clearly in the help(fcn).
